The use of IoT-based applications to retrieve data in relatively real-time has increased significantly. One of the applications is weather monitoring application called Rendeng (Rapid Envelopment Data Sending). The aim of this application is not only to collect weather data, but also to present the weather information as the user's needs. Rendeng, developed for specific user characteristic, has four different education backgrounds, which are: Informatics, Mathematics, Statistics, and Physics. Therefore, there is a need to test the usability of the application in order to gain the value of efficiency, effectiveness, satisfaction, and learnability of the application in achieving those goals. Considering the difference education background, this is a specific test for an application having likely characteristic with Rendeng. However, research on the usability testing towards the weather monitoring application is rarely conducted. Regarding to previous studies in this area, the aim of this study is to test the usability of Rendeng application. The results show that Rendeng has drawbacks in terms of efficiency and effectiveness with scores 73.4% and 77.8%, respectively. In contrast, Rendeng gives advantages in satisfaction with score about 81.1% and in learnability with score about 74.5%.
